> >>>> * Scantling Saywas*
> >>>>
> >>>>
> >>>>
> >>>> Even though the walls
> >>>>
> >>>> Collapsed like lungs
> >>>>
> >>>> Even though to speak
> >>>>
> >>>> Burnt like a grate
> >>>>
> >>>> Even though your body
> >>>>
> >>>> Melted into space
> >>>>
> >>>> Even though the blank
> >>>>
> >>>> Was flamed through with holes
> >>>>
> >>>>
> >>>>
> >>>> The morning still maintained
> >>>>
> >>>> A message from before
> >>>>
> >>>> The paths still proclaimed
> >>>>
> >>>> Footfall echo maps
> >>>>
> >>>> And afternoons still basked
> >>>>
> >>>> A scent of light turning
> >>>>
> >>>>
> >>>>
> >>>> Over on an open river
